Budaur

Madhya Pradesh — Palera, Tikamgarh • Rural
Budaur is a rural settlement in Palera, Tikamgarh, Madhya Pradesh. It has a population of 3,065 in about 720 households (avg size: 4.26). Approximate literacy: 54.19%.

Population of Budaur

Population (Total)3,065
Male1,597
Female1,468
Children (0–6 years)510
Households720
Literate persons1,661
Illiterate persons1,404
Total workers1,513
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)919
Literacy (approx.)54.19%
SC population1,606
ST population38
